Test Plan Note — Calendar Sync Conflict (Tindervale Scheduler)

Scenario: two clients edit the same event offline, then sync. Expected behavior: the Larkmoor merge service keeps the later timestamp and files a conflict record. Verify the losing edit appears in the conflicts pane and no duplicate events are created. Run against the staging tenant only. Authenticate your test client to the sync endpoint using the bearer token below.

bearer token for hagug-kawip: eyJhbGciOiJIUzI1NiIsInR5cCI6IkpXVCJ9.eyJzdWIiOiIydxNAjDeTmIn0.L86yxoGFcrhy

**Mgmt Meeting Minutes — Retiring the Brightline Range**

Quick recap for sales leads at Fenholt Supplies: we agreed to retire the Brightline fixture range by year-end. Remaining stock moves to clearance pricing next month, and accounts on standing orders get migrated to the Lumetta range. Trade-in incentives were approved in principle. The confidential note on next steps sits just below.

board note of bajof-bajeg: The pricing group signed off on a budget of $13.4 million for Project Sildor. The renewal with Lamixek Holdings closes at $48.9 million a year, 49 percent above the last contract.

Balances are derived, never stored directly, so tampering requires rewriting history — the nightly hash-chain verifier should catch that. Main concerns to probe: the manual-adjustment endpoint (admin role only, but role checks were refactored last month) and the CSV import path for partner batches, which skips signature validation in staging. Redemption reversal logic is in reversal_engine.py. Access questions should go to the service owner named below.

named custodian: Brivan Eliath Quenox Frador

## Session Handling for Health Checks

The Corvel gateway sits behind the Lanternside load balancer, which probes /healthz every ten seconds. Health-check requests are stateless by design: they bypass the session store entirely so that probe traffic never inflates session counts or evicts real user sessions. New team members should note that the deep-check endpoint, /healthz/deep, does verify session-store connectivity and therefore requires authentication. When probing it manually, supply the token below.

bearer token for tajep-kajef: eyJhbGciOiJIUzI1NiIsInR5cCI6IkpXVCJ9.eyJzdWIiOiIoOsZ23In0.CsygO0hs